NOT as good as it seems. stay clear December 4, 2007 not over the hill yet (UK) 15 out of 15 found this review helpful
I wanted a good all round cheap card reader so I opted for the G-Tech 19-in-1 memory Card Reader/Writer. UNFORTUNATELY Not plug a play as tried it in 7 different pcs with differnt usb chip sets and 4 different o/S. = Win xp pro, 2000 pro, win me , linux edubuntu. (also tried some tricks of the trade) BUT All the same yellow exclaimation marks in the device manager. All my other usb devices work ok, so this item has major driver problems/issues/incompatibilities. The actual item looks realy nice and would be great if it worked. It comes with no instructions or drivers just a USB lead and the card reader itself.Apparently the manufacturers china/japanese website have drivers for win98 but all other o/s after 98 = Plug and pray! Company not terifically helpful like returning calls but did send out a quick replacement which did exactly the same and an envelope to return the faulty suspect one. As yet waiting for a refund but to no avail as they say they have not recieved it yet ( about 10 days so far????)My opinion is I am staying clear of this brand and may opt for a renowned brand or more likely a PCMCIA reader for the laptop. You have been warned (from a pc technician engineer who would likes to think he knows what he is doing when installing PC peripherals as he has been in the trade at least 17 years now)
